Transaction 812655e765ab789c53202bf30f11716fd38a087419c3667534415694e0f5379d
1 Input
1 Output
-
812655e765ab789c53202bf30f11716fd38a087419c3667534415694e0f5379d:0
- value
- 750028
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1861100754ecf5c12bbe1a939fe8544c12349e0
- address
- bc1q6xrpzqr4fm84cy4mux5nnl59gnqjxj0qdapl93